Trebuchet is a bespoke eshot system designed and programmed by ourselves. The name Trebuchet comes from the medieval siege weapon that would throw boulders or flaming balls over great distances. The aim was to breach a castle wall prior to attack. Replace flaming boulders for emails and you get the concept.
